Fox HUNTER’S Wilier

Hi fellas!

as you requested on fixedgeartaiwan.com – here’s some smooth and beautyful ride from Cologne…..
here’s the data…..for pics check the attachment…..:

Name: Fox HUNTER’S Ride
Frame: Wilier Pista 2009 (Alu)
Fork: Carbon (orig.)
Rims/Hubs: Miche Pista TS (orig.)
Spokes: 28/32 (orig.)
Tires: CST Ultra Speed (orig.)
Pedals: Shimano Deore XT (custom)
Crank/Chainring: Miche Primato Advanced Pista 135mm/48t (orig.)
Chain: Miche Pista (orig.)
Cogs: Miche Pista 16t/16t (orig.)
BB: Miche Primato (orig.)
Handlebar: Nitto RB-018 (custom)
Stem: Ritchey Pro 26,0/ 110mm (custom)
Headset: FSA (semi integrated) (orig.)
Brake: Campagnolo Mirage (orig.)
Brake Lever: Paul E-Lever
Seatpost: Ritchey (orig.)
Saddle: Selle Italia Filante (orig.)

Review (as far as i can say after hardly 100 KM due to the f***** up winter with snow and sh***y minus degrees) :
Compact track ride with street style attitude.
Easy-to-handle setup with bullhorn-bar and absolutely stylish brake-lever makes it a perfect everyday-use-commuter with the genetic aggressiveness of a track racer.
